About Swanson Elementary

Swanson Elementary is a public elementary school in Palmer, AK, part of Matanuska-susitna Borough School District, serving approximately 343 students in grades Pre-K-2nd with a 14.9:1 student-teacher ratio. It holds a MySchoolScout rating of 7.0 out of 10 and ranks #135 of 412 schools in AK. Based on limited data: 44% component coverage.
